The paper focuses on the tenure fate of three Commons: the 30 million hectares of paturelands in Afghanistan, which represent at least 45% of the toal land area and are key to livelihood and water catchment in that exceedingly dry country; the 5.7 million hectares of timber-rich tropoical forests in Liberia, 59% of the total land area; and the 125 million hectares of savannah in Sudan, half the area of the largest state of Africa.
